  • RCL FOODS is a leading African food producer in South Africa with a market capitalisation of R13 billion and employing more than 20 000 people in operations across South and Southern Africa. We manufacture a wide range of branded and private label food products which we distribute through our own route-to-market supply chain specialist, Vector Logistics. ...

    Receipting Clerk

    • Our team is on the lookout for a talented Receipting Clerk to join the Procurement team at our Milling Site in Pretoria West. This role would report to the Senior Buyer.
    • The Receipting Clerk will be responsible for executing the goods receipting of all the Milling items, services and finished products for resale.

    Duties & Responsibilities    
    Daily Operational Execution:

    • Receipting of non-stock items, service items and finished product for resale in compliant and timely manner.
    • Ensure compliance with established procedures and company standards including levels of authority.
    • Ensure that high level of house-keeping are maintained.

    Non-Stock Items:

    • The Receipting Clerk must verify that a Purchase Order (PO) exists for the delivery being received. Stock can only be receipted against an ERP system PO.
    • Once the PO has been identified, Receipting clerk who physically received the items must check the delivery note against the physical stock for following: Item correctness, Quantity of stock, and Visual quality.
    • If there is no PO on the system, the stock must be returned back to the vendor by means of a goods returned advice.
    • Once the Receipting Clerk is satisfied that the stock is correct and that the PO exists the supplier delivery note must be signed, the delivery note retained and a copy returned to the supplier; and approved copy is submitted to the creditors department.

    Services:

    • Where services have been received: The service invoice and job card (if applicable) must be signed by the End User / or Cost Centre Owner as evidence of the service having been performed.
    • The invoice and applicable job card must be submitted to the Operational Procurement for receipting.
    • The Receipting Clerk will capture the receipt on the ERP system.
    • Where original service invoices are received by the Operational Procurement; original invoices must be submitted to the Creditors Department for payment after goods receipt capture has been completed.
    • After completion of above steps, the Receipting Clerk must create a service entry sheet on the ERP system.

    Receipting of Finished Product for Resale:

    • Same principles required as per above.
    • Attention to detail on goods receipting batch numbers based on approved received by SHEQ
    • Ensure receipting is completed with 24 hours of receipt of all relevant supporting documentation.

    ERP Processing:

    • The Receipting clerk must create and / or capture the goods receipt on ERP system against the PO.
    • Delivery note number must be included on Goods Receipt entry.
    • For batch managed items, each batch must be captured on a separate line on the goods receipt.
    • Once the goods receipt has been captured, the Receipting Clerk must write the Goods Receipt number onto the delivery note and file it.
    • All delivery documents from the supplier must be filed.
